ttm.dabeuliou.com
Japanese release for TTM - The Red Vinyl
I found more informations about the Japanese release for the album. So, the date is Tuesday 25 March on Hydrant Music. There will be 2 bonus tracks, but they’re know by the fans for a long time : Ain’t No Telling (Live at The Kore) and Lovers And Fighters (Live in the living room). Both […]